51.Antonym of DELETE a. impound b. insert c. inspire d. injure

Option”B” is correct Delete : remove or obliterate (written or printed matter), especially by drawing a line through it. Impound : seize and take legal custody of (something, especially a vehicle, goods, or documents) because of an infringement of a law. Insert : place, fit, or push (something) into something else. Inspire : fill (someone) with the urge or ability to do or feel something, especially to do something creative. Injure : do physical harm or damage to (someone). Antonym of Delete is Insert
52.Antonym of PERDITION a. excitement b. reward c. inspiration d. salvation
Option”D” is correct Perdition : (in Christian theology) a state of eternal punishment and damnation into which a sinful and unrepentant person passes after death. Excitement : a feeling of great enthusiasm and eagerness. Reward : a thing given in recognition of service, effort, or achievement. Inspiration : the process of being mentally stimulated to do or feel something, especially to do something creative. Salvation : preservation or deliverance from harm, ruin, or loss. Antonym of Perdition is Salvation
53.Antonym of ARROGANT a. proud b. meek c. insolent d. rude
Option”B” is correct Arrogant : having or revealing an exaggerated sense of one’s own importance or abilities. Proud : feeling deep pleasure or satisfaction as a result of one’s own achievements, qualities, or possessions or those of someone with whom one is closely associated. Meek : quiet, gentle, and easily imposed on; submissive. Insolent : showing a rude and arrogant lack of respect. Rude : offensively impolite or bad-mannered. Antonym of Arrogant is Meek
54.Antonym of CONSPICUOUS a. indifferent b. harmless c. insignificant d. unknown
Option”C” is correct Conspicuous : clearly visible. Indifferent : having no particular interest or sympathy; unconcerned. Harmless : not able or likely to cause harm. Insignificant : too small or unimportant to be worth consideration. Unknown : not known or familiar. Antonym of Conspicuous is Insignificant
55.Antonym of SUCCUMB a. curb b. resist c. injure d. shoot
Option”B” is correct Succumb ; fail to resist pressure, temptation, or some other negative force. Curb : a check or restraint on something. Resist : withstand the action or effect of. Injure : do physical harm or damage to (someone). Shoot : kill or wound (a person or animal) with a bullet or arrow. Antonym of Succumb is Resist
56.Antonym of JUDICIOUS a. unequal b. unlawful c. impure d. indiscreet
Option”D” is correct Judicious : having, showing, or done with good judgement or sense. Unequal : not equal in quantity, size, or value. Unlawful : not conforming to, permitted by, or recognized by law or rules. Impure : mixed with foreign matter; adulterated. Indiscreet : having, showing, or proceeding from too great a readiness to reveal things that should remain private or secret. Antonym of Judicious is Indiscreet
57.Antonym of EXONERATE a. compel b. accuse c. imprison d. boldness
Option”B” is correct Exonerate : (of an official body) absolve (someone) from blame for a fault or wrongdoing. Compel : force or oblige (someone) to do something. Accuse : charge (someone) with an offence or crime. Imprison : put or keep in prison or a place like a prison. Boldness : willingness to take risks and act innovatively; confidence or courage. Antonym of Exonerate is Accuse
58.Antonym of AMNESTY a. hostility b. punishment c. immunity d. acquittal
Option”B” is correct Amnesty : an official pardon for people who have been convicted of political offences. Hostility : hostile behaviour; unfriendliness or opposition. Punishment : the infliction or imposition of a penalty as retribution for an offence. Immunity : the ability of an organism to resist a particular infection or toxin by the action of specific antibodies or sensitized white blood cells. Acquittal : a judgement or verdict that a person is not guilty of the crime with which they have been charged. Antonym of Amnesty is Punishment
59.Antonym of MORTAL a. eternal b. spiritual c. immortal d. divine
Option”C” is correct Mortal : (of a living human being, often in contrast to a divine being) subject to death. Eternal : lasting or existing forever; without end. Spiritual : relating to or affecting the human spirit or soul as opposed to material or physical things. Immortal : living forever; never dying or decaying. Divine : of or like God or a god. Antonym of Mortal is Immortal
60.Antonym of LEAP a. plunge b. sink c. immerse d. fall
Option”D” is correct Leap : jump or spring a long way, to a great height, or with great force. Plunge : jump or dive quickly and energetically. Sink : go down below the surface of something, especially of a liquid; become submerged. Immerse : dip or submerge in a liquid. Fall : move from a higher to a lower level, typically rapidly and without control. Antonym of Leap is Fall
